Advantages for Employers
Training to become a Legal Executive has advantages
over the solicitor’s route to qualification, for both the
individuals and for the firms they work for.
The ILEX route to qualification as a a lawyer enables
individuals to “earn as they learn”, often having their own case
loads, and to earn fee income for their employers. This is
attractive to firms, as they do not have to contend with the
administrative regulations laid down by the Law Society for trainee
solicitors.
It allows firms to recruit specialist trainee lawyers who
will earn an income for them straight away. This is why the adverts
for legal executives’ jobs have multiplied in recent years.
Legal Executives fill pivotal posts in a variety of
organisations, not just legal firms. For example, this year's
graduation ceremony was attended by newly qualified Legal Executive
employees from organisations such as Disney ABC International
Television; HSBC Insurance UK Ltd; AXA UK PLC; Capita
Life & Pensions Services Ltd; Ministry of Defence; Kent County
Council; Plymouth City Council; Rentokil Initial PLC;
RSPCA; and The Peabody Trust.
